Linda Johnson was born in New York City on December 23, 1947 to Isaac and Izola Johnson. She departed this life on Saturday, February 27, 2021.
Linda was educated, from Kindergarten through High School, in the Public School System in New York City.
Linda was formerly employed in the retail industry before her retirement.
Linda had two children, Denise and Willie (R.I.P.).
Throughout her childhood, she received her religious training at Second Canaan Baptist Church where she was a member of the Junior Usher Board. When Linda recommitted her life back to the Lord, she immediately began serving as a faithful member of the Missionary Ministry.
Linda Johnson was known everywhere for her big beautiful smile and sense of humor. Never to take nonsense from anyone.
Linda loved her community and until her decline in health in recent years, she volunteered her service on the James Weldon Johnson Tenants Association. Linda also devoted her time as an active Poll Worker for the Board of Elections for numerous years.
Linda leaves to mourn her memory: her daughter, Denise Johnson-Phillips; son-in-law, Johnathan L. Phillips; granddaughter, Nykia D. Phillips; two sisters, Mary Agnes Spann of South Carolina and Gertrude Burns of New York City; sister-in-law, Julia Anderson; and a host of nieces, nephews, cousins and friends to remember special times spent with her.
